Day 17: Battle Stories

📖 1 Timothy 6:12; 2 Timothy 4:7

💡 Go After Jesus Principle #17
Every spiritual Soldier has a few battle stories to share. You are not alone because Jesus goes with you.

✍️ Devotional Thought
Paul described the Christian life in battle terms: “Fight the good fight of the faith” and later, “I have fought the good fight, I have finished the race, I have kept the faith.” Every Soldier of Jesus has stories of battles faced and victories won by God’s grace.

Some battles are internal — struggles with temptation, doubt, or fear. Others are external — persecution, criticism, or opposition. In each, you learn that you are not alone. Jesus is with you on the frontlines. His Spirit strengthens you, His Word steadies you, and His presence keeps you from giving up.

You may even carry scars from the fight. But those scars become testimonies of God’s faithfulness. They remind you and others that Jesus never abandons His Soldiers.
